Output d6d7ec681ae125ca79f64b31d0d06f138bb94de0a7a05bac0431a0ad5e9e7346:0

value
3388238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7567de3c698a0733afc1a51a1f621ff89be4196 OP_EQUAL
address
3MKcpLfipMVcTACtNkwP9tVHgvibKyuPcx
transaction
d6d7ec681ae125ca79f64b31d0d06f138bb94de0a7a05bac0431a0ad5e9e7346
confirmations
193149
spent
true